A most appealing and attractively proportioned mature semi-detached house with scope for improvement set with generous gardens in this prestigious and sought after locality.
NO ONWARD CHAIN.

Directions - From Shrewsbury town centre proceed over the Welsh Bridge and on arrival at Frankwell roundabout take the first left turn onto Copthorne Road. Proceed to the top of the bank taking the next left turning into Pengwern Road. Proceed to the end, at the T junction turn right onto Porthill Road. At the next roundabout turn left onto Roman Road and continue along passing Kingsland School on the left hand side and as you reach the bottom of the dip, the property will be identified in an elevated position on the left hand side.

Situation - The area is also known being one of Shrewsbury's most sought after residential localities. Easy access is gained to a number of local amenities including an excellent selection of schools, both private and state. The town centre is within walking distance which provides an excellent shopping centre, a selection of restaurants and social facilities. Commuters have ready access to the A5 which links through to the M54 motorway and on to Telford. There is also a rail service available in the town centre.

Description - 21 Roman Road is a highly desirable and attractively proportioned semi-detached house. The ground floor boasts, 2 reception rooms and a good sized kitchen. To the first floor there are 3 bedrooms and a bathroom. Buyers should note that there is excellent scope to introduce their own ideas and tastes, together with extension possibilities subject to the relevant planning permissions. Outside there is driveway parking and a garage. The gardens are particularly generous in size and currently comprise large flowing lawns and give great potential for further landscaping.
